Cylch Meithrin Llangybi is looking for an energetic, enthusiastic and reliable individual to work as an assistant in the Cylch. It is essential for the individual to be fluent in Welsh or a learner who has reached a high level. Interviews will be held the following week.

Job Details

  • Salary: National Minimum Wage
  • Hours: Monday to Thursday 9.00-13.00 (16 per week)

Qualifications Required

  • A level 2 qualification in Childcare is required, or willing to work towards a qualification with 'Cam wrth Gam'.
  • Experience of working with early years is also required.
